  • change tick labels

    There are several ways to change tick labels in Graph Builder.

    New in JMP17: via Configure Levels. Before JMP17, one could use Value Labels: ... and there is a nice shortcut to apply them very quickly:
    - click on a tick label and hold the mouse button for some while.-  the axis will change to edit mode- edit the label- press ESC
